omniminder is a script for connecting OmniFocus to Beeminder goals. This tool depends on AppleScript, which is only available in the Pro flavors of OmniFocus. While it may work with OmniFocus Pro 2, I am only using it and testing it with OmniFocus Pro 3. The script also depends on Node.js. I suggest using Node Version Manager (nvm) to get an up-to-date version of Node.js, which can easily be installed via Homebrew. omniminder is intended to run whenever OmniFocus syncs. While there isn't any official way to run scripts on the sync event in OmniFocus, the modified time on the app's database file ($HOME/Library/Containers/com.omnigroup.OmniFocus3/Data/Library/Application Support/OmniFocus/OmniFocus.ofocus) reliably changes whenever a sync occurs. I use Noodlesoft's Hazel to run the script in response to the file changing. If you don't own Hazel, you could also set up a cron job or just run the script manually. The OmniFocus automation is itself implemented using JavaScript for Automation, but executed from within the context of Node.js scripts (so that they can interact with the Beeminder API conveniently).
